N-iX vs Sigma Software Group: overview

N-iX

N-iX has run since 2002, reporting headquarters in Valletta, Malta, with delivery centers across Poland, Ukraine, Romania, and Bulgaria and over 2,400 professionals worldwide. Publicly named clients include Bosch, Siemens, eBay, and Questrade. Its AI practice has delivered more than 50 projects covering readiness assessment, LLM engineering, custom agents, multi-agent orchestration, and RAG pipelines, all inside a much larger cloud, data, and embedded software business.

Sigma Software Group

Sigma Software Group was founded in 2002 and is headquartered in Stockholm, Sweden, with a reported headcount between 1,001 and 5,000 employees. The group covers Java and .NET development, web and mobile development, and general software delivery, with generative AI listed as one of several specialties rather than a founding focus. Its Nordic base and enterprise scale make it a fit for buyers who want generative AI paired with broader software engineering under one European vendor.
